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Lympstone Commando to Bourne End start from as little as £27.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Lympstone Commando to Bourne End start from £55.40 one way, or £98.30 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Lympstone Commando to Bourne End are available for £136.90 one way, or £273.80 return

Facilities at Lympstone Commando

At Lympstone Commando, customers will encounter minimalistic facilities which cater to a basic, yet practical, passenger experience. Importantly, the station lacks a formal ticket office and ticket machines, meaning that tickets must be purchased and collected elsewhere. The station does feature an induction loop for those with hearing impairments, but it falls short on other accessibility features, including a complete absence of step-free access.

While waiting rooms and lounges aren't available, passengers have access to a seating area to rest while waiting for connections. Support such as help points are provided, and the station staff is available to offer assistance should additional support be needed. Travelers should plan around the absence of amenities like shops, ATMs, restrooms, and cycling facilities, ensuring to prepare essentials before their arrival.

Facilities and Amenities at Bourne End Station

For those looking to purchase tickets, Bourne End Station offers a ticket office open weekdays from 06:05 to 12:35 and on Saturdays from 07:05 to 13:35. While there is no service on Sunday, ticket machines are available 24/7 for your convenience. Additionally, there's full accessibility support with accessible ticket machines and induction loops.

The station is equipped with CCTV for security and customer help points for any information you may need. You can stay informed about your journey with departure screens and announcements. Even though there's no luggage storage, and lost property services are limited, there's comfort in knowing the essentials are covered.

Accessibility is a strong point here. Featuring step-free access across the platforms with a short ramp from the car park, Bourne End ensures ease of transit for everyone. While there are no waiting rooms or first-class lounges, the seating areas provide a place to settle while you wait. For those who require assistance, staff help is available from Monday to Saturday.

While shopping facilities are not present, you can quench your thirst with refreshment options via vending machines on Platform 1. There's free space for bicycles, and cycling to the station makes for an eco-friendly commute option with secure racks and stands available.

Onward Travel from Bourne End

When it comes to additional transport, Bourne End doesn’t disappoint. Though taxi services directly at the station are unavailable, buses conveniently stop just outside the station. This connects you efficiently to Marlow and Maidenhead, providing smooth transitions onward. If you're catching a flight, transfer at Reading for Heathrow and Gatwick links or Bristol Temple Meads for Bristol Airport.

Planning to cycle further? While there is no bicycle hire service available at Bourne End, bicycle storage is plentiful, securing peace of mind for bike owners.
